Abstract
HCV affects approximately 3% of the worldwide population. Egypt has a high prevalence rate of HCV infection and as much as 90% is genotype 4. More than 65% of Egyptian patients with HCC are positive for HCV 4. The Clinical trials data showes that SVR rate
